The Meaning Behind the Hei Toki

 

The Toki (adze) was an essential tool in traditional Māori society – used for carving waka, shaping whare, and clearing land. To wear a Hei Toki is to carry the mana of the creator, the builder, and the provider.

 

It represents:

  • Strength and determination – the ability to face challenges head‑on
  • Leadership and responsibility – guiding others with integrity
  • Skill and craftsmanship – honouring the work of one’s hands

 

Worn close to the chest, the Hei Toki grounds the wearer, reminding them of their own inner power and the legacy they are building.

According to tradition, pounamu was born from Papatūānuku. Her tears of sorrow and joy flowed into the rivers of Te Waipounamu (the South Island) after her separation from Ranginui (the Sky Father). These tears crystalised into pounamu, imbuing the stone with her mauri (life force) and mana (spiritual power).
